PASIGHAT, Apr 5: Election General Observer Dilip Routray on Thursday this evening expressed hope that the upcoming Lok Sabha and Assembly elections scheduled to be held on April 19 next would be transparent and peaceful manner in East Siang district. Appreciating the hard work DEO Tayi Taggu, Routray stated that preparations for its completion were continuing on a war footing for all three assembly constituencies and East Arunachal Parliamentary constituency in the district was appreciable, said the GO adding that “I am very happy to see the management including sincerity, dedication and tireless efforts of the government officials and the leadership of the DEO Taggu”. 
GO informed that he has been traveling and visiting all polling booths of all three constituencies—37-Pasighat West, 38-Pasighat East and 39-Mebo Assembly Constituencies and arrangements were made according to ECI guidelines and very satisfactory. He also informed that he was closely monitoring all developments and concerned election officers were updating him on regular basis. Sharing his contact number, Routray assured that for any election related issue would be taken very seriously and he would always be available to attend call of common public and political parties grievances to address promptly. 
DEO Tai Taggu while throwing light on polling preparation stated that the district was all set to conduct the elections and was waiting for polling day. All the officials of government departments and police and other defense forces deployed for elections were also performing their assigned jobs and responsibilities with full dedication. If things continue like this, the upcoming elections would be conducted completely peacefully and in transparent manner in the district.
